Newswise — An occasional facial wax or bikini wax is the only treatment most women need to control unwanted hair. But those who find themselves in a constant battle with coarse, dark hairs that grow in patterns typical of men may be dealing with a common symptom of an often-overlooked but usually treatable hormone imbalance.

Androgens are known as male hormones but they also circulate in lesser levels in women's bloodstreams. In fact, several necessary male hormones are produced by the ovaries and other organs and glands. If they exist in lower-than-normal amounts, a woman may experience decreased sex drive and fatigue and be vulnerable to osteoporosis. In excess, androgens often lead to acne, balding or thinning hair on the scalp, irregular or absent menstrual periods, fatigue, decreased sex drive, and the abnormal hair growth called hirsutism.

The intricate mechanisms producing androgens and other hormones that impact androgen availability and strength are the first links in an entwined chain of events that ultimately affect individual sites such as hair follicles, skin pores and eggs in the ovaries. The effectiveness of treatment, therefore, depends on finding and addressing the defective point or points in the sequence while providing therapy for bothersome symptoms.

Although androgen excess " which typically is seen in the years from adolescence to menopause " causes many symptoms that are readily visible, underlying causes are more challenging to detect. The inability to become pregnant, for example, may stem from a variety of causes, and many women who suffer from hirsutism believe they are destined for a life of plucking, tweezing or paying for expensive treatments, never knowing that a serious medical condition may be responsible.

"The overwhelming majority of women with hirsutism have an underlying androgen disorder," says Dr. Azziz. Because hair overgrowth is so common to the disorder and so problematic to the sufferer, Dr. Azziz and several of his colleagues have made a concerted effort to inform electrologists about the medical implications of hirsutism.

"Electrologists tend to be the front line for patients with hirsutism," he says. "When electrologists recognize that they are treating a symptom that is part of a larger disorder, they are able to give appropriate referrals, which enables patients to find the diagnostic and treatment help they need."

Although adrenal gland disorders and certain tumors occasionally contribute to excessive androgen levels, about 80 percent of patients will be found to suffer from an endocrine disorder called polycystic ovary syndrome (PCOS), according to Dr. Azziz.

Women with PCOS have numerous small cysts on the periphery of their ovaries and experience a variety of symptoms, such as menstrual irregularities, skin problems, and excess weight. Many are found to have insulin resistance, a condition that allows excessive levels of insulin to circulate in the blood. Risks of developing Type II diabetes, hypertension and heart disease are increased.

According to Dr. Braunstein, while it is recognized that five or six percent of women in their reproductive years will have polycystic ovary syndrome and androgen excess, such precise statistics are not available for the population of women with androgen insufficiency syndrome, for two reasons.

"There have not yet been widespread epidemiologic studies on androgen insufficiency, and the assays for measuring androgens in women have been relatively insensitive. They have been optimized for measuring the androgens of males, while the levels in women are normally 1/10th to 1/20th of those in males," says Dr. Braunstein. "It is important to have a very good, sensitive assay to measure the levels in women."

Women with androgen insufficiency syndrome typically experience a constellation of symptoms that warrant further investigation: decrease in libido, decline in sense of well-being or quality of life, fatigue, possibly a slower-than-normal growth rate of pubic hair, and a likelihood of bone density problems.

To progress toward a diagnosis, physicians will evaluate the signs and symptoms and find out if a clinical situation exists " such as removal of ovaries, adrenal or pituitary disorders, or menopause " that is known to be a factor in androgen deficiency.

"In the premenopausal woman, about a quarter of the androgens are produced directly by the ovaries and about a quarter by the adrenal glands. About half comes from the conversion in various tissues " such as the skin and liver " of precursors, "prohormones" from the ovaries and the adrenals, into more potent androgens. When a woman has her ovaries removed, about half of the androgen production actually decreases. The same is not true for someone going through natural menopause because the androgen production continues from the ovaries," says Dr. Braunstein.

"Many women who have had their ovaries removed, those with adrenal or pituitary diseases, and some individuals with natural menopause may have a low libido that is part and parcel of a low testosterone level," he adds.
